> I've updated the draft with fast_bitset and small_bitset.
> 
> https://github.com/fmatthew5876/stdcxx-bitset
> 
> I had some ideas for additional directions to go into. I've not put these in the paper.
> 
> Some new public members:
> 
> template <size_t N, typename T> class bitset {
>   public:  
>     using underlying_type = T[N / (sizeof(T) * CHAR_BIT) + 1];
> 
>     array<T,sizeof(underlying_type) / sizeof(T)> get_underlying() const;
>     void set_underlying(array<T,sizeof(underlying_type) / sizeof(T)> a);
>  
> 
> get_underlying() would return an array of T whose bits are identical to the bits stored in the bitset. All of the bits > N would be 0.
> set_underlying(a) would set the internal bits to the values of the bits in a. All of the bits > N are ignored.
> 
> Alternatively, instead of value semantics we could do reference semantics:
> template <size_t N, typename T> class bitset {
>   public:  
>     using underlying_type = T[N / (sizeof(T) * CHAR_BIT) + 1];
> 
>     array<T,sizeof(underlying_type) / sizeof(T)>& rep();
>     const array<T,sizeof(underlying_type) / sizeof(T)>& rep() const;
> 
> 
> This is more dangerous as bitset is a value type which can be freely copied, but it might be more efficient for large bitsets.
> 

In my opinion this is a very useful feature! A lot of times I've wanted to use bitset but I couldn't because
I also needed to directly access the underlying data. I think this is a fundamental flaw in the current std::bitset
design. I'd farther suggest to make it simple to tie a bitset to an already existing buffer. Would it be difficult
to standardize a "bitset_view" class that just adapts an existing random access container and expose the
bit access capabilities of bitset? Then the old bitset could be implemented by wrapping this view over
a std::array, while wrapping over an array_view would make it possible to access already existing buffers.
Wrapping it over an std::vector, we'll have boost::dynamic_bitset for free.
In this way you could make the old bitset a simple typedef (given that the current proposal would
break the ABI anyway, why not?), but you could also leave bitset alone, not breaking the ABI in any way, 
and let users that need more power to use bitset_view over whichever container they like.

What do you think about this idea?
